study guides for every class

that actually explain what's on your next test

Language

from class:

Ergodic Theory

Definition

Language is a system of communication that uses symbols, such as words or gestures, to convey meaning and facilitate interaction among individuals. In the context of symbolic dynamics, language is crucial for representing the states and behaviors of a dynamical system, allowing for the description and analysis of complex structures through simple symbols.

congrats on reading the definition of Language. now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. In symbolic dynamics, language is used to encode trajectories of dynamical systems into sequences of symbols, making it easier to analyze their behavior.
  2. The construction of a language involves defining an alphabet and establishing rules for how symbols can be combined to form valid sequences.
  3. Languages can be finite or infinite; finite languages consist of a limited number of sequences, while infinite languages can generate an unlimited variety of sequences.
  4. Understanding language in symbolic dynamics helps in connecting mathematical concepts with real-world systems, providing insights into the underlying structure and behavior.
  5. The study of language in this context leads to various applications, including coding theory, where information is represented efficiently using symbolic sequences.

Review Questions

  • How does language serve as a tool for encoding the behavior of dynamical systems in symbolic dynamics?
    • Language serves as a tool for encoding the behavior of dynamical systems by transforming complex trajectories into manageable sequences of symbols. This encoding allows researchers to analyze the underlying patterns and structures within the system using simpler representations. By mapping states and transitions to specific symbols, one can gain insights into the system's dynamics and predict future behavior.
  • Discuss the importance of defining an alphabet in constructing a language for symbolic dynamics.
    • Defining an alphabet is crucial in constructing a language for symbolic dynamics because it determines the set of symbols that will be used to represent different states and behaviors. The choice of alphabet influences how effectively one can encode complex behaviors into symbol sequences. A well-chosen alphabet ensures that all relevant states can be captured while minimizing redundancy, making the analysis clearer and more efficient.
  • Evaluate how understanding language in symbolic dynamics can impact broader mathematical theories and real-world applications.
    • Understanding language in symbolic dynamics significantly impacts broader mathematical theories by providing a framework for analyzing complex systems through simple symbol manipulation. This insight not only enriches theoretical mathematics but also enhances real-world applications like coding theory and information transmission. By bridging abstract concepts with practical implementations, one can develop more efficient algorithms and models that address problems across various fields such as computer science, biology, and economics.
ยฉ 2024 Fiveable Inc. All rights reserved.
APยฎ and SATยฎ are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.
Glossary
Guides